Gas chromatography-ion mobility spectrometry(GC-IMS)was used to determine the flavor components of Citri Reticulatae Pericarpium(Chenpi)from 10 different geographical origins including Xinhui.To establish a method for the identification of Xinhui Chenpi,the 75 identified flavor components were analyzed by principal component analysis(PCA)and partial least squares discriminant analysis(PLS-DA).The results showed that the proposed method could distinguish Xinhui Chenpi from those from other regions.Meanwhile,by analyzing the variable importance in projection(VIP),we selected 20 key characteristic markers to distinguish Xinhui Chenpi from other Chenpi.In conclusion,the combined application of GC-IMS and PLS-DA allows the accurate identification of Xinhui Chenpi,providing a new technical reference for the protection and origin tracing of Xinhui Chenpi as a national geographical indication product in China.
